CATHERINE H. CORNETTE
BLACK MOUNTAIN - Catherine Harrison Cornette, 76, formerly of Mars Hill, died May 3, 1996, at a local area health facility.
She was a native of Catawba County, and a daughter of the late William and Ida Harrison.
She was preceded in death by her first husband, Raymond Helton; her second husband, J.T. Cornette; and three stepsons.
Survivors include three sons, Howard Helton and Gary Helton of Hickory and Carroll Helton of Florida; two daughters, Barbara LaPlante of Swannanoa and Martha Canter of Todd; two stepdaughters, Sadie Davis of Conover and Catherine Rowe of Hickory; 24 grandchildren, 32 great-grandchildren and two great-great-grandchildren.
The Funeral will be conducted by the Rev. Frank Cantrell at 2 p.m. Monday at Brigman's Valley Funeral Service in Black Mountain.
Burial will be in the Radford Cemetery in Mars Hill.
The family will be at the funeral home from 4 to 6 p.m. today.
